site stats

Implementation of interrupt priority

WitrynaQuestion. Sub:-Computer organization. Note:- explain with dia need clear explanation interrupt requests and priority. Transcribed Image Text: With a neat diagram explain the implementation of interrupt priority using individual interrupt- request and acknowledgment lines. WitrynaFig: Implementation of Interrupt Priority using individual Interrupt request acknowledge lines. Each of the interrupt request line is assigned a different priority level. Interrupt request received over these lines are sent to a priority arbitration circuit in the processor. A request is accepted only if it has a higher priority level than that ...

Answered: With a neat diagram explain the… bartleby

Witryna1 paź 2024 · Assign PIE group priority levels GxyPL (where x = PIE group number 1 - 12 and y = interrupt number 1 - 8) These values are used to assign a priority level to each of the 8 interrupts within a PIE group. A value of 1 is the highest priority while a value of 8 is the lowest. More then one interrupt can be assigned the same priority level. WitrynaPriority Interrupt. Priority Interrupt is an independent game studio. Founded in 2024 by Chad Cuddigan and Joshua Skelton, we make games just like you wished they used … how much are blue takis https://massageclinique.net

High-rate task scheduling within AUTOSAR - Vector Informatik …

WitrynaTo configure the priority of an interrupt, we can take advantage of the fact that the interrupt priority registers are byte addressable, making the coding much easier. For example, to set IRQ #4 priority level to 0xC0, we can use the following code: ; Setting IRQ #4 priority to 0xC0 LDR R0, =0xE000E400 ; External Interrupt Priority Register Witryna13 kwi 2024 · From: Jinliang Zheng . According to the hardware manual, when the Poll command is issued, the. byte returned by the I/O read is 1 in Bit 7 when there is an interrupt, and the highest priority binary code in Bits 2:0. The current pic. simulation code is not implemented strictly according to the above. WitrynaThe interrupt priority defines which of a set of pending interrupts is serviced first. INTMAX is the most favored interrupt priority and INTBASE is the least favored … photography masters london

External Interrupt Extension and Software Implementation of …

Category:What happens when an ISR is running and another interrupt …

Tags:Implementation of interrupt priority

Implementation of interrupt priority

HANDLING MULTIPLE DEVICES - IDC-Online

Witryna23 lis 2024 · Actually, in my understanding, the kernel interrupt priority must be lowest. This is because a context switch happens at kernel interrupt time, and in order to save a valid task context to which to switch back to orderly, the kernel interrupt must never interrupt ISRs, only tasks. And yes, enabling interrupts will (must) also enable the … Witryna28 lut 2014 · The Cortex Microcontroller Software Interface Standard ( CMSIS) provided by Arm Ltd. is the recommended way of way of programming Cortex-M …

Implementation of interrupt priority

Did you know?

WitrynaThe series of MCS 51 Single Chip Microcomputer (SCM) only have two external interrupts and two interrupt priorities. This paper introduces three methods for the … Witrynainterrupt priority An allocated order of importance to program interrupts. Generally a system can only respond to one interrupt at a time but the rate of occurrence can be …

Witrynafrom others, depending upon the device’s priority. To implement this scheme, we can . assign a priority level to the processor that can be changed under program control. The . priority level of the processor is the priority of the program that is currently being ... Figure2: Implementation of interrupt priority using individual interrupt ... WitrynaThe implementation depends on the processor, the type of interrupt controller used, and the design of the architecture and machine itself. Figure 6.1 is a diagram of the …

Witryna20 kwi 2016 · For hardware interrupts, Priority Interrupt Controller Chips (PIC's) are hardware chips designed to make the task of a device presenting its own address to … WitrynaIf you wish to assign an interrupt a low priority do NOT assign it a priority of 0 (or other low numeric value) as this can result in the interrupt actually having the highest …

Witrynathe AUTOSAR application tasks may interrupt each other. But it would be unacceptable for an AUTOSAR task to be allowed to interrupt, or block, the high-rate scheduled task and therefore the priorities need to be allocated such that the high-rate task has the highest priority in the system. This means that the high-rate task can interrupt any …

WitrynaIt is worth noting that nested interrupt handling is a choice made by the software, by virtue of interrupt priority configuration and interrupt control, rather than imposed by hardware. A reentrant interrupt handler must save the IRQ state and then switch core modes, and save the state for the new core mode, before it branches to a nested ... how much are blythe dollsWitrynabits c-a are the bits the GIC might implement, that are RAZ/WI if not implemented. the GIC must implement bits H-a to provide the maximum 256 priority levels. ARM recommends that, for a Group 1 interrupt, bit [7] is set to 1. A Non-secure access can only see a priority value field that corresponds to the Non-secure view of interrupt … photography materialsWitryna26 paź 2024 · Firstly, if multiple interrupts are to be used, the program has to be designed carefully, otherwise it might be a mess. One interrupt can come up within a … photography masters degree onlineWitryna3 paź 2012 · Prioritize interrupts properly Interrupt prioritization is important in determining the order of execution when two or more interrupts occur … photography maternity dress walmarthow much are blue tongue skink at petcoWitrynaAn implementation might reserve an interrupt for a particular purpose and assign a fixed priority to that interrupt, meaning the priority value for that interrupt is read-only. This model aligns with the priority grouping mechanism described in Priority grouping. how much are black walnut trees worthWitrynaEngineering Computer Science With a neat diagram explain the implementation of interrupt priority using individual interrupt- request and acknowledgment lines. With … how much are boarding kennels